Crescenzo Cecere, the representative of Inter Milan goalkeeper Andrei Radu, has clarified to TuttoMercatoWeb why the transfer to Al-Shabab has collapsed in the winter transfer window.

All the operations in January are difficult, it’s not easy to find the right solution. For me this was a simple operation and we had also found the economic agreement [with Al-Shabab], but at the last moment the club did not release the injured South Korean goalkeeper [Kim Seung-gyu] and we were unable to deposit the contracts given that Saudi League is based on the MLS model with blocked lists for foreign players.
